Types of Chairs & Stools

Armchair:

An armchair is a comfortable and typically upholstered chair with armrests on either side. It's designed to provide support and relaxation while also offering a stylish addition to any room. Armchairs come in various styles, from classic and traditional to modern and sleek, and they can be found in living rooms, bedrooms, and even office spaces.

Recliner:

A recliner is a type of armchair that has a reclining backrest and often a fold-out footrest. It's designed for ultimate comfort, allowing the user to adjust the angle of the backrest and elevate their legs. Recliners are commonly found in living rooms and home theaters, offering a cozy spot for relaxation and watching movies.

Accent Chair:

An accent chair is a decorative chair designed to complement the overall decor of a room. It often features unique patterns, colors, or textures that stand out from the rest of the furniture. Accent chairs can be use to add a pop of color or a touch of elegance to a space.

Dining Chair:

Dining chairs are designed for use at dining tables. They come in a variety of styles, including traditional, modern, and contemporary. Dining chairs can be upholster or have wooden or metal seats, and they're commonly available in sets to match dining tables.

Bar Stool:

Bar stools are tall, narrow stools designed for use at bars, kitchen islands, or high tables. They typically have a footrest for added comfort and are available in various heights to accommodate different counter or bar heights. Bar stools can have backrests and cushioned seats or be more minimalist in design.

Counter Stool:

Similar to bar stools, counter stools are design for use at kitchen counters or elevated surfaces. However, they are slightly shorter to accommodate counter height. They also come in a variety of styles and materials to match different kitchen aesthetics.

Rocking Chair:

A rocking chair is a chair that rests on curved legs, allowing the user to rock back and forth. It's often associat with relaxation and is commonly use on porches, in nurseries for soothing babies, or simply as a comfortable reading chair.

Office Chair:

An office chair is design for use at a desk or workspace. It often features ergonomic design elements such as adjustable height, lumbar support, and swivel functionality. Office chairs are important for maintaining good posture and comfort during long periods of work.

Folding Chair:

Folding chairs are portable chairs that can be easily fold and stored when not in use. They are commonly use for temporary seating at events, picnics, or in spaces with limited room.

Stool:

A stool is a simple, backless seat often with three or four legs. Stools come in various heights and can serve a variety of purposes, from casual seating at a kitchen counter to being use as a step stool or even as a decorative piece.

Safety Considerations for Chairs and Stools:

Stability: One of the primary safety concerns is the stability of chairs and stools. They should be well-construct and balanc to prevent tipping over when someone is sitting on them or leaning back.

Weight Capacity: Always adhere to the weight capacity indicated by the manufacturer. Overloading a chair or stool can lead to structural damage and potential accidents.

Material Quality: Ensure that the materials use to construct the chairs and stools are of high quality. This includes checking for sturdy frames, durable upholstery, and reliable joints.

Non-Slip Features: If using stools or chairs on slippery surfaces, consider options with non-slip features on the legs to prevent sliding and accidental falls.

Ergonomics: When selecting chairs, especially for office use, prioritize ergonomic designs that support proper posture and reduce the risk of strain-related injuries.

Sharp Edges and Corners: Check for any sharp edges or corners that could pose a risk of injury. Especially if chairs or stools are place in areas with high foot traffic.

Proper Use: Educate users about proper sitting techniques and the intended use of the furniture. For example, discourage standing on stools not designed for that purpose.

Regular Inspection: Periodically inspect chairs and stools for signs of wear and tear. Replace or repair any damaged parts promptly to maintain safety.

Child Safety: If there are children in the household or space, choose chairs and stools that are appropriate for their age and size, and ensure they are use under supervision.
